12. Structure-Based Design and Synthesis of Protease Inhibitors Using Cycloalkenes as Proline Bioisosteres and Combinatorial Syntheses of a Targeted Library
Sammanfattning : Structure-based drug design and combinatorial chemistry play important roles in the search for new drugs, and both these elements of medicinal chemistry were included in the present studies. This thesis outlines the synthesis of protease inhibitors against thrombin and the HCV NS3 protease, as well as the synthesis of a combinatorial library using solid phase chemistry. LÄS MER

14. Structure, dynamics and reactivity of carbohydrates : NMR spectroscopic studies
Sammanfattning : The main focus of this thesis is on the ring conformations of carbohydrate molecules; how the conformational equilibria and the rates of the associated interconversions are affected by the molecular constitution and their surroundings.The conformational equilibria of a group of amine linked pseudodisaccharides, designed as potential glycosidase inhibitors, comprising α-D-altrosides are described in Chapter 3. 15. Development and Applications of Molybdenum-Catalyzed Chemoselective Amide Reduction
Sammanfattning : This thesis covers the development of catalytic methodologies for the mild and chemoselective hydrosilylation of amides. The first part describes the investigation of the Mo(CO)6-catalyzed reduction of carboxamides. LÄS MER
